Coley, did you play around with the stuffing below the driver yet? If you have some there, take it out and see how it sounds. Adjust to your liking. I have no stuffing in mine with the TB W4-930.
I only have stuffing behind the internal baffle pretty much as the damping plan looks. I have none in front on the internal baffle. could you explain more on what should i expect from changing the stuffing around. (more, less, none, in front of baffle, behind.)??
